Breaky Bottom Vineyard, East Sussex, Cuvée David Pearson 2015

In the glass, the wine shows a pale lemon hue. Its aroma is quintessentially “Champagne,” with discreet yet alluring hints of freshly baked brioches and delicate pastry notes enveloped in a buttery veil. On the palate, its piercing acidity commands is softened by a delicate touch of sweetness that emerges in the aftertaste, reminiscent of sweet lemon curd. The wine’s mineral and linear character adds depth and complexity, leaving a lasting impression of refinement and finesse.
